Google has unveiled its dedicated URL submission feature within Search Console, allowing updated URLs to show directly in search results.
Google's new service
With the addition of Google’s new service, users can submit URLs straight to the Google index, but that’s not the final step.
Google does not guarantee the addition of all submitted URLs as updates will need to be vetted and cleared, a process which has not been fully disclosed.
I am not a robot
Users will still need to pass a basic Captcha as a part of the URL submission process before updates can be incorporated into the index.
It's unclear as to when Google initially released this new tool but the update has met positive feedback from users and web page clients.
Streamlining the process and offering guaranteed results seems to be a ways away but its certainly a progressive move towards stronger indexing.
